The UEFA Champions League knockout stage continues this Tuesday with a thrilling first-leg encounter between Monaco and Paris Saint Germain. The match will take place at the Stade Louis II, where the hosts aim to make the most of their home advantage before the return leg in Paris. Both sides are eager to take a crucial step toward qualification for the round of 16, and with plenty of attacking talent on display, this fixture promises to deliver high-quality football and drama.
Monaco enter this clash after a 3-1 victory over Nantes, a result that boosted their confidence following a mixed run of form. Over their last five matches, they have recorded two wins, two draws, and one defeat, averaging 1.6 goals scored and 0.8 conceded per game. Despite their resilience, consistency has been an issue, as reflected in their Champions League campaign so far — two wins, four draws, and two losses, with an average of one goal scored and 1.8 conceded per match.
At home, Monaco have shown defensive discipline, with Under 0.5 goals recorded in two of their last ten Champions League fixtures at the Stade Louis II. However, their attacking output has been modest, and they will need to find more creativity to challenge PSG’s solid backline. The Red and Whites have managed to stay unbeaten in their last four home UCL matches (three draws and one win), a streak they will hope to extend against the reigning champions.
Injury concerns remain a major obstacle for the hosts. Several key players are sidelined, limiting their options in both defense and attack. Nevertheless, the presence of in-form striker Florian Balogun, who has scored eight goals this season including three in the Champions League, offers hope. His partnership with Simon Adingra, who netted twice at the weekend, could be crucial in breaking down PSG’s defense.
Paris Saint Germain approach this match as favorites, despite a recent 3-1 defeat to Rennes in domestic competition. That setback ended a four-game unbeaten streak, but their overall form remains strong. In their last five matches, PSG have collected three wins, one draw, and one loss, averaging two goals scored and one conceded per game. Their Champions League record this season stands at four wins, two draws, and two defeats, with an impressive average of 2.6 goals scored and 1.4 conceded per match.
Les Parisiens have been particularly dominant in the first halves of their European fixtures, having avoided defeat at half time in 19 of their last 20 Champions League matches. They have also won the first half in seven of their last ten away games in the competition. Moreover, over 0.5 goals in the second half have been scored in 24 of their last 26 matches, highlighting their attacking persistence throughout the game.
PSG’s attacking depth remains one of their biggest strengths. Vitinha leads their scoring charts in Europe with five goals, while Ousmane Dembélé has found the net three times in his last two appearances. With additional firepower from Khvicha Kvaratskhelia, Desire Doué, and Gonçalo Ramos, the visitors have multiple options capable of turning the game in their favor. The team’s only absentees are Fabian Ruiz and Quentin Ndjantou, leaving the rest of the squad available for selection.
This will be the first-ever European meeting between Monaco and Paris Saint Germain, adding an extra layer of intrigue to an already fascinating tie. The two sides last met in Ligue 1, where Monaco claimed a narrow 1-0 victory. However, PSG’s superior form in both domestic and continental competitions suggests they will be eager to avenge that defeat.
Statistically, PSG hold the upper hand. They have won three of their last five head-to-head encounters, scoring an average of 2.6 goals per match against Monaco. The hosts, meanwhile, have managed just one win in that span. While Monaco’s defense has improved recently, their injury crisis and inconsistent finishing could prove costly against a PSG side that thrives on attacking momentum and late surges.
Given the attacking profiles of both teams, goals are expected. PSG’s matches frequently feature high-scoring outcomes, and Monaco’s home form suggests they will contribute to the spectacle. The visitors’ ability to maintain pressure throughout both halves could be decisive, especially considering their record of scoring in nearly every second half of their recent Champions League fixtures.
